Responsibilities

  • Preparing delicious, high-quality food that delights our clients and customers
  • Crafting eye-catching food and counter displays that draw customers in
  • Proudly representing DINE and and embodying our positive brand image
  • Handling transactions with ease and operating the cash register efficiently
  • Upholding the highest standards of Food Handling & Hygiene
  • Ensuring a safe and healthy work environment by adhering to Health & Safety regulations

Dine provides tailored food services to 140 clients in the business and industry sector. With over two decades of industry experience, we pride ourselves on offering a personalised approach to our clients, whilst delivering outstanding service. Our passion lies in creating great-tasting menus, promoting sustainability, and proudly working with local suppliers and communities. That?s why our menus feature only locally sourced, seasonal, and sustainable ingredients with a target of reaching Climate Zero by 2030.
